It really is as bad as the reviews say

I started out in this place for 6 months (doesn't end until December) and I won't be renewing. My friends live in this apartment complex as well in a different building. They have had water leaking from their ceiling many times and recently it was especially bad - they pressed on the wall and water squirted out. The first time they had leaks they were told by maintenance they would just have to deal with it - so they laid towels out to soak up the water. Eventually word got back to the manager and she did have it fix, but now they have this other problem. If you look at the ceilings you can tell where this is a common problem and the drywall has been soaked through many times before. I think this is also why the air quality seems so terrible. There is likely mold in between the floors - I'm always stuffy inside.

Don't use the after hours service they won't contact them, or if they do the info is ignored.

I witnessed a neighbor be busted for drug charges (I had to air my apartment out several times because it smelled so much like marijuana and NO I didn't say anything to anyone because I was scared of what might happen to me. I just had to open all my windows and air my apartment out). They were not evicted, even though the lease I signed stated you will be if you're caught with drugs in the apartments.

The bottom floors of the apartments are suspiciously unused and completely torn up inside; the doors are missing their locks and they isn't any carpet on the floor. Since they are 'full' on 1 bedrooms, you'd think they would fix these so they could rent them. Since they aren't, I'm assuming something makes them unlivable. One building has the glass broken out of it and ivy is growing into the building. Yes, into. Lord only knows how many bugs and stuff are getting in-especially since most of those doors aren't locked or shut properly.

My windows have no sealing around them. This isn't such a big deal because utilities (heat and air) are included. But it does make a difference that bugs are coming in the window and I keep killing them on my desk.

At least two buildings near me have been without air for most of the summer. Mine went out a few days ago and every time I call they tell me its fixed and just to wait. Right now my apartment is 85 degrees.

I'm not sure if it's the complex's fault or not, but this place also gets power surges pretty regularly. I've never experienced it before in the handful of places I've lived in Lexington. Yesterday one was so hardcore we heard it hit and we almost lost power.

I came here for "cheap" living to get me by for a few months. The truth is the prices aren't that cheap (I was lucky and got a deal and it still isn't worth it). And as terrible as everything is here, I can't even recommend it to you for a short-term stay.
